Per AISC (ref. attached file) holes and slotted holes are categorized in 4 groups-standard holes, oversized, short slotted and long slotted.
Intelligent connections shall have these standard hole / slot sizes included, it is an industry standard.
All macros shall coordinate washer location-per AISC washer shall be adjacent to oversized or slotted holes. If oversized or slotte dholes are persent on both outer plies, the two washers shallk be used one on ea side.
Currently on some macros we do not have an option to ovesize holes (Galble wall end plate for example).
IMO all macros shall be coordinated with AISC, and options to be available for std, ovesized, short slotted or long slotted holes.
There should be an option long slotted holes to have plate washers covering the slot, in other words, bolt assembly may require to be bolt-grip-plate washer-nut or similar.
